First I want to state up front that I am not a football fan, so when I found out that the book was about football I had no desire to even pick it up, but I kept hearing such wonderful things about the book that I finally broke down & started reading it. I must confess thatin the first couple of pages, I had the typical "girl" reaction & I was convinced that I was going to never pick this book up again, football....blah....blah....blah.....but then I really got it..... It's not about football, it about his obsession with football & all of the thoughts, actions & reactions that go along with his obsession. After a few more stories about his "obsession" I started to realized that this book could be applied to any boy, guy and/or man that I have ever known! I couldn't stop laughing nor could I put the book down! Nick Hornby's honest & hard look at his life-long obsession with Arsenal, or perhaps more to the point.... his analysis of his life & how it has possibly caused this obsession is a total delight to read! Then, once I realized that Nick himself reads the Audio Book version of the book, I just knew that I had to hear Nick Hornby's own voice tell his story - I have truly enjoyed every second of the book & the tape, several times over!
